Abstract: Special solvent oil was prepared from the middle and low temperature coal tar suspension bed hydrogenation fraction via hydrofining route on a 100 mL fixed bed reactor. The effects of temperature, pressure, hydrogen-oil ratio, LHSV ,different fractions and process schemes on product properties were studied. The results showed that the two-stage hydrogenation process was more suitable for the hydrogenation of coal based solvent oil with distillates below 300 ℃ as raw materials. The catalyst LP-D for coal-based solvent oil was filled in the first reactor, and the oil-based solvent oil hydrogenation industrial agent LK-1 was used in the second reator. The first rector's temperature was 320 ℃, hydrogen-oil ratio was 600, LHSV was 0.50 h-1, and pressure was 16 MPa. The second reactor's temperature was 360 ℃, hydrogen-oil ratio was 600, space velocity was 0.33 h-1, pressure was 16 MPa. The mass fractions of sulfur, nitrogen and aromatics in the generated oil were reduced to 0.8, 0.5 μg/g and 0.08% respectively after being hydrotreated. The process can meet the production requirements of environmental protection special solvent oil.
